### Option 2: Manual

```bash
pip install code-governance
```

**Quick scan** — no config needed, instant results:

```bash
$ governance-ast --auto src/

Governance Report (python)
Modules: 8 | Files scanned: 47

Violations (1):
  [E] [no_cycles] Circular dependency: payments -> notifications -> payments

FAILED
```

**Full setup** — generate config, review, enforce:

```bash
# Generate config: detect modules + seed cannot_depend_on by locking down
# every module pair that does not currently import from each other.
governance-ast --generate --source-root src/

# See the dependency map
governance-ast --discover

# Edit governance.toml — remove dependencies you don't want, add layers
# Then enforce:
governance-ast
```

## What it catches

| Rule | Example |
|------|---------|
| `enforce_cannot_depend_on` | `api` imports `billing` but `billing` is in `cannot_depend_on` |
| `no_cycles` | `payments` -> `notifications` -> `payments` |
| `enforce_layers` | `db` (infrastructure) imports from `api` (presentation) |
| `max_public_surface` | 80% of `core`'s symbols used externally — too exposed |
| `min_cohesion` | `utils` imports 90% from other modules — grab-bag module |

### Adopting on legacy codebases

```bash
governance-ast --save-baseline .governance-baseline.json
governance-ast --baseline .governance-baseline.json
```

Accept existing violations. Only fail on new ones.

### Transitive detection

```bash
governance-ast --transitive
```

Detects indirect violations through dependency chains. If `api` has `cannot_depend_on = ["db"]` and `api → service → db`, the transitive check catches it. Also works with layer enforcement. Enable permanently in config with `transitive = true` under `[rules]`.

## Comparison

| | code-governance | tach | import-linter |
|---|---|---|---|
| **Zero-config scan** | `--auto` — instant | No | No |
| **Config generation** | `--generate` from source | `tach init` (interactive TUI) | Manual |
| **LLM advice** | `--advise` — explains + suggests fix | No | No |
| **CI comments** | PR comments with explanations | No | No |
| **Auto-fix from PR** | `/governance fix` | No | No |
| **AI agent plugin** | Claude Code plugin | No | No |
| **Diff mode** | `--diff HEAD` | No | No |
| **Baseline** | Accept existing, fail on new | No | No |
| **Module metrics** | Cohesion, surface, symbols | No | No |
| **HTML report** | Dependency matrix viewer | `tach show` | Browser UI |
| **JSON output** | Yes | Yes | No |
| **Scans source directly** | Yes | Yes | No — must be importable |
| **Interface enforcement** | No | Yes | No |
| **Transitive imports** | Full chain (`--transitive`) | Direct only | Full chain |
| **Forbidden imports** | `cannot_depend_on` | `cannot_depend_on` | Forbidden contract |
| **Visibility control** | No | Yes | No |
| **Speed (Django)** | ~1.2s | Sub-second (Rust) | ~0.1s (grimp) |
| **Config syntax** | Simple TOML lists | TOML with regex | INI or TOML |
| **Maintenance** | Active | Abandoned by original team | Active, slow |

**Choose tach** if you need interface enforcement or visibility control (note: unmaintained).
**Choose code-governance** if you want transitive detection, AI-guided setup, CI integration, or zero-config scanning.
